The Flow Cytometry Sub-micron Particle Size Reference Kit provides six sizes of green-fluorescent beads (ranging in diameter from 0.02 μm to 2.0 μm) packaged in individual vials. Each bead is uniform in size, and the green-fluorescent dyes are localized within the bead, which makes the beads brighter and more photostable than conventional surface-stained beads.

These size standards can help identify small bioparticles such as exosomes, bacteria, and viruses in experimental samples. This kit can also be used as a tool to verify instrument performance and establish parameters suitable for analyzing sub-micron particles, including:
• Particle size resolution limit and dynamic range
• Sensitivity of forward and side scatter photomultiplier tubes
• Level of instrument baseline noise
• Laser and optical alignment and stability
• Stability of the fluidics system

The bead diameters are determined by transmission electron microscopy, and the beads are provided as 2 mL suspensions with a density of ∼1× 106 beads/mL.

Specifications
ColorGreen
Diameter (Metric)0.02, 0.1, 0.2, 0.5, 1.0, 2.0 μm
Quantity6 x 2 mL
Product TypeFlow Cytometry Particle Size Reference Kit
Unit SizeEach
Contents & Storage
Store at 2°C to 8°C. DO NOT FREEZE.
